    During my time at Electric Boat, I served as the lead engineer assigned to develop a component refurbishment program. Given the long life expectancy of submarines, inevitably some manufacturers either go out of business or no longer support a certain product or component. Once that obsolescence is identified, a replacement solution is required unless there is a sufficient inventory of repair parts.     Deloitte is one of the Big 4 public accounting firms organized as a limited liability partnership. It has offices in multiple locations, including Wilton, Connecticut, where it houses certain firm-wide functions included as part of its National Office.     Professional business consulting firms help business to improve general performance when they are having problems. After analyzing a business ' management style, practices, technology usage, and other mechanical features that make up a business, a firm will then draw up a report and make recommendations on how the business can improved based on their conclusions.     Consulting Consulting occurs in a hierarchical relationship between the supervisor and the supervisee (Capuzzi & Stauffer, 2012). The supervisor and supervisee will work together to solve problems and provide indirect benefits to clients (Capuzzi & Stauffer, 2012). There are four characteristics of consulting, which are expertise, capability, complementary, and the need for consultation (Capuzzi & Stauffer, 2012).
